After successful completion of the course, students are able to explain quantities and laws, energy and forces in the current flow, electric and magnetic field, to understand general and local quantities of the electromagnetic field as well as the basic electrical circuit elements, to calculate simple circuits in DC, single-phase and poly-phase AC networks, to explain the operational characteristics of transformers and electrical machines, finally to know basic measuring instruments in electrical engineering and to apply measuring techniques.
The written examination consists of calculation examples and a theoretical part with sub-questions (multiple-choice). For some sub-questions calculations are mandatory, but the computational effort is much lower than for the calculation examples.
